Things aren’t looking good between new parents Keke Palmer and Darius Jackson.

Though Palmer has wavered over how much of her relationship she wants to share with the public, the Hollywood triple threat had shown nothing but respect and adoration for the fitness instructor on social media. “It’s so cringy writing a birthday post for you because the love is so sacred,” Palmer wrote of Jackson in January 2023. “It almost feels asinine to try to share or give a glimpse into something that only we could understand. I can share most things so easily, but not you.”

However, Jackson didn’t mind using Twitter to air his grievances with the mother of his child. In July 2023 the fitness instructor shocked Palmer’s fans when he publicly shamed the Nope star for wearing a sheer dress to an Usher concert. He then removed all photos of Palmer from his social media feeds, per Page Six.

Like the Big Boss she is, Palmer proceeded to post a series of stunning photos of her look on Instagram. Sorry to this man….

Here’s a complete timeline of Keke Palmer and Darius Jackson's relationship.

May 2021: Palmer and Jackson meet at an Insecure after-party hosted by Diddy. Palmer appeared on the popular HBO series, while Jackson’s brother Sarunas Jackson played the role of Alejandro “Dro” Peña. “I walked up to him,” Palmer will later say on The Terrell Show in June 2023. “My best friend was like, ‘You should just say something to him. You should ask if he wants a drink.’”

And later on in the show: “Here’s the thing. He’s very fine. But he has that personality where it’s like, Do you know you’re fine? When I walked up to him, I was not looking for love. I was looking for a roster, you understand? And so I was like, ‘He fits the physical bill.’ But when I talked to him…he was such a sweetheart. I think what I saw was he’s just a sweet guy.”

August 2021: The pair go Instagram-official, with the Nope star sharing a kissing photo among others from her 28th-birthday party. “It’s the details for me. Nobody was on they phones, we had that before MySpace feeling…. I’m so happy,” she captioned the post, which was later deleted. “Awesome Birthday, so grateful.”

October 2, 2021: The pair are photographed looking loved up at the Veuve Clicquot Polo Classic in Los Angeles.

PACIFIC PALISADES, CALIFORNIA - OCTOBER 02: (L-R) Darius Daulton Jackson and Keke Palmer attend the Veuve Clicquot Polo Classic Los Angeles at Will Rogers State Historic Park on October 02, 2021 in Pacific Palisades, California. (Photo by Gregg DeGuire/Getty Images)

March 17, 2022: Palmer opens up about going public with her relationship in an interview with Bustle. “I just think [this] was a moment in time in my life where I really stepped into this kind of boss behavior [of doing] whatever the hell I want to do,” she says. “This is the happiest I’ve ever felt with someone. So why would I go out of my way to hide this person? That’s a lot more work than just living in my life and being in my life. You know what I’m saying?”

December 4, 2022: Palmer reveals she’s pregnant while hosting Saturday Night Live.

December 24, 2022: Jackson kisses Palmer’s baby bump in a sweet Instagram Boomerang. “Mom n dad,” he wrote over the Instagram story, per People.

January 21, 2023: Palmer posts a sweet birthday tribute to Jackson.

January 28, 2023: Palmer shares a series of baby bump portraits featuring herself and Jackson as the “King and Queen” with a little “prince” on the way. “A long time ago, in a land not so far… The King and Queen got together to play,” she captions the Instagram post. “The play turned to love as many sunsets passed by. Now there’s a prince, who’s soon to arrive!”

The pair host a “Once Upon a Baby” extravaganza the same day the portraits were taken, with various partygoers sharing photos and videos from the baby shower—including a video of Palmer and Jackson getting down to Beyoncé.

February 3, 2023: Palmer shares the story of how she found out she was pregnant on an episode of her podcast, Baby, This Is Keke Palmer. She says she took a pregnancy test on a “random” whim, tossing the test in the trash when she thought it was negative. Later, Palmer gets “a text from Jackson, and he says, ‘When did you take this?’ And it’s a picture of the pregnancy test and it’s positive,” she related. As it turns out, Palmer didn’t wait long enough for the test to fully develop. “I’m like, ‘I took that earlier today, like literally just some hours before I left out.’ And he said, ‘Well, you better get to be drinking water in your sight. ’Cause I’m buying 10 of these things right now. You take them all when you get home.’”

February 25, 2023: Palmer and Jackson welcome their first child, a son named Leodis Andrellton Jackson.

April 29, 2023: Palmer and Jackson pose with baby Leo at the closing night screening of her Big Boss documentary at the 2023 Atlanta Film Festival.

ATLANTA, GEORGIA - APRIL 29: Keke Palmer, Leo Jackson and Darius Jackson attend the "Big Boss" Closing Night Screening during the 2023 Atlanta Film Festival at Rialto Center for the Arts at Georgia State University on April 29, 2023 in Atlanta, Georgia. (Photo by Carol Lee Rose/FilmMagic)

July 4, 2023: Palmer tweets, “Not tryna be the person but… I love my man. (PERIODT!)”

July 5, 2023: Jackson seems to publicly shame Palmer on Twitter over the sheer dress she wore to a Usher concert in Vegas. “It’s the outfit tho.. you a mom,” Jackson writes in response to a video of his girlfriend being serenaded by the singer.

After facing major backlash, he doubles down with a second tweet, writing, “We live in a generation where a man of the family doesn’t want the wife & mother to his kids to showcase booty cheeks to please others & he gets told how much of a hater he is.”

He continues, “This is my family & my representation. I have standards & morals to what I believe. I rest my case.” (The tweets have since been deleted.)

July 6, 2023: Palmer appears unbothered by Jackson’s tweets, posting a series of photos of her ’fit on Instagram, writing, “I wish I had taken more pictures….”

Meanwhile, Jackson seems to briefly deactivate his Twitter and Instagram, per Page Six.

July 7, 2023: Though Jackson is back on social media, Page Six reports that all photos of Palmer have been removed from his Instagram feed. Palmer and Jackson don’t follow each other on the app.

Meanwhile, Palmer pulls an Ariana Madix and drops some well-timed merch seemingly inspired by the drama. “One thing is certain and one thing is true, IM A MOTHA, through and through! 😍,” she captioned an Instagram video serenading her son to “Isn’t She Lovely,” by Stevie Wonder. “‘IM A MOTHA’ and ‘Stevie to the bullshit’ shirts available NOW! Link in bio :).”

According to Complex, “Stevie to the bullshit” refers to a quote she made during an episode of Baby, This Is Keke Palmer, which featured Jackson. The “I’m a Motha” crewneck retails for $45 and runs from a size XS to 3XL, while the “To the Bullshit” tee is selling for $30 in two colors.

If that wasn’t enough of a response, Palmer also shares a TikTok with a new memeable audio. “You ain’t stopping what’s going on with me, sweetheart,” she says. “So if you gon act up, I’m bouta link up.”

She captions the dance video, “Ayeeeeeee get into this mixxxx.”

July 12, 2023: Fans notice that in an episode of Baby, This Is Keke Palmer recorded before all the drama (but posted to YouTube later), Jackson addresses the pressures of a relationship in the spotlight and his pressure on Keke, saying, “You almost feel that pressure of needing to be perfect. And so it really confused me and infiltrated my mind because not only did I have to hold myself to that perfect standard, I was also holding you to a perfect standard as well…So, any moment of flaw on my side or on your side it was World War III because it's like….” Per People, Palmer added, “And now the world sees us.”

August 16, 2023: Palmer stars in the music video for Usher's new song “Boyfriend.” Lyrics include, “Somebody said that your boyfriеnd’s lookin' for me. / Oh, that’s cool, that’s cool. / Well, he should know I’m pretty easy to find. / Just look for me wherever he sees you.”

August 26, 2023: Jackson and Palmer go live on Instagram while celebrating her 30th birthday. “D, thank you for taking me out on my birthday as always,” Palmer said to Jackson in a clip shared by Pop Crave. “I mean, it’s not always my birthday but you always do take me out. But I just thank you for making it special for my birthday, that’s so sweet.”

During their live stream, Jackson refers to Palmer as his “partner in crime,” while Palmer seems to hint at a possible reconciliation. “Get into the Virgos and admit that Virgos are the one,” Palmer jokingly tells Jackson. “It’s already too late, your Virgo already has you hooked.”

September 4, 2023: Palmer and Jackson attend Beyoncé's Renaissance tour together in Los Angeles.

September 25, 2023: Palmer tells Hoda Kotb and Jenna Bush Hager to “mind y'all's business” when they ask about her relationship with Jackson.

“Not y’all trying to get into it! They trying it on the Today show,” Palmer joked when the subject was first brought up on Today With Hoda & Jenna. When the hosts say they just want to know if Palmer is “happy,” the singer replies in the affirmative. However, when she's pressed on whether she's grateful “for the relationship” she responds, “I’m not trying to be specific!”

Still, Hager attempts to get to the bottom of things by flat out asking whether the couple are together, to which Palmer responds, “I’m going to take a page out of my girl Beyoncé’s book: Mind y’all’s business.”

Watch here:

November 9, 2023: Palmer makes the decision to file for a restraining order against Jackson and request sole custody of Leodis, the eight-month-old son they share. She is granted both.

In court documents reviewed by People, Palmer accused Jackson of domestic violence on multiple occasions over the course of their two-year relationship—which, she further noted, “finally ended for good” in October “primarily due to the physical and emotional abuse [he] inflicted.”

Palmer went on to specifically cite a November 5 incident in which Jackson “trespassed into my home without my knowledge or consent” and “threatened” her before “lunging for my neck, striking me, throwing me over the couch, and stealing my phone.” Palmer also recalled Jackson “destroying my personal property, including diaries and prescription eyeglasses, throwing my belongings into the street, throwing my car keys to prevent me from driving away, hitting [me] in front of our son, spewing profanities about me to our son, threatening to kill himself with a gun if I left him, harassment, and other physical and emotional abuse.”

December 9, 2023: Palmer tells fans her “life is truly unraveling” in an Instagram post that appears to target fan conspiracy theories that her breakup with Jackson is a part of some elaborate PR strategy. “When reality TV makes everyone believe all celebrities lives are just one big marketing strategy,” she captioned an Instagram video holding her son Leo while dressed in a red robe. “But my life is truly unraveling at the seams and I just wear trauma like a [Dolce & Gabbana] coat bc Sharon didn't raise no b****.”
